SWFT are back for 2026, taking a look at the philosophy of the Force and presenting it via a montage of clips and moments from across Star Wars media, including moments from video games including Star Wars Jedi: Survivor.

A cinematic montage exploring the philosophy behind the Force from Star Wars.

‘Star Wars: A New Hope’ (1977), ‘Star Wars: The Empire Strikes Back’ (1980), ‘Star Wars: Return of the Jedi’ (1983), ‘Star Wars: The Phantom Menace’ (1999), ‘Star Wars: Attack of the Clones’ (2002), ‘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ic II: The Sith Lords’ (2004), ‘Star Wars: Revenge of the Sith’ (2005), ‘Star Wars: The Clone Wars’ (2008), ‘Star Wars Rebels’ (2014), ‘Star Wars: The Force Awakens’ (2015), ‘Rogue One: A Star Wars Story’ (2016), ‘Star Wars: The Last Jedi’ (2017), ‘Solo: A Star Wars Story’ (2018), ‘The Mandalorian’ (2019), ‘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ker’ (2019), ‘Star Wars: The Bad Batch’ (2021), ‘Star Wars: Visions’ (2021), ‘The Book of Boba Fett’ (2021), ‘Obi-Wan Kenobi’ (2022), ‘Andor’ (2022), ‘Tales of the Jedi’ (2022), ‘Star Wars Jedi: Survivor’ (2023), ‘Ahsoka’ (2023), ‘Tales of the Empire’ (2024) & ‘The Acolyte’ (2024)

Chapters:
0:00 – Part 1: A Violent Storm
2:30 – Part 2: Look Into the Fire
7:00 – Part 3: The True War
